No Preview Available ! PreliminaryData Sheet
μPD5753T7G
SiGe/CMOS Integrated Circuit
4 × 2 IF Switch Matrix with Tone/Voltage Controller
R09DS0014EJ0100
Rev.1.00
Feb 22, 2011
FEATURES
• 4 independent IF channels, integral switching to channel input to either channel output
• 4 × 2 switch matrix with integrated switch control - Tone/Voltage
- Switch’s Enable/Disable function is linked with POLA input voltage level
• Switch’s Enable condition : VPOLA > 9.5 V
• Frequency range
: f = 250 MHz to 2150 MHz
• High isolation
: ISLD/U = 33 dB TYP. @Worst mode
• Insertion loss
: LINS = 7 dB TYP. @ ZS = ZL = 50 Ω
• Insertion loss flatness
: ΔLINS = 1.0 dB TYP.
• 20-pin 4 × 4 mm square micro lead package ( 20-pin plastic QFN (0.5 mm pitch))
APPLICATIONS
• DBS IF switching
• Multiswitch, Switch box
• 4 × 2 switching application for microwave signal
